Skids typically offer a cost-effective solution for businesses aiming to optimize their logistics processes. Their simpler design and open structure result in reduced manufacturing and material costs compared to crates.
Crates take the lead when it comes to safeguarding valuable, fragile, or sensitive items. Their enclosed structure provides superior protection against external elements, impacts, and tampering. Crates are often preferred for high-value products like electronics, artwork, or precision machinery.
Skids are designed for rapid and efficient handling. They are compatible with forklifts, pallet jacks, and conveyor systems, making them ideal for quick loading and unloading. In contrast, crates may require more time and care when opening and closing, which can impact productivity.
Skids are versatile and adaptable to various industries and applications. They are commonly used for the transportation of general goods, palletized loads, and bulk items. On the other hand, crates tend to be specialized for specific products that demand heightened protection.
Both skids and crates can be customized to accommodate specific product dimensions and protection requirements. Crates often feature cushioning or padding to ensure the safety of delicate items. Skids, while customizable, do not provide the same level of enclosed protection.
Skids, particularly those made from sustainable materials, can align with eco-friendly practices. Wooden skids, for example, are often reusable and recyclable. Crates, being more complex and often treated for durability, may have a higher environmental impact.
Skids find extensive use in industries where efficient handling and storage are paramount, such as retail, manufacturing, and agriculture. Crates are favored in sectors where product integrity and security are of utmost concern, including high-end retail, electronics, and fine art transportation.

Skids and crates serve different purposes in pressure vessel packaging. A skid is essentially a single-deck loading platform that offers support and stability to heavy items during transport. It’s a flat structure where the pressure vessel can be placed and secured. In contrast, a crate is a closed or semi-closed container that encloses the pressure vessel, providing protection from external elements and additional support. While skids are more about stability and ease of handling, crates offer comprehensive protection.
The choice between skids and crates significantly affects the safety and integrity of pressure vessels during transit. Skids, with their open and flat structure, are suitable for stable, short-distance transport where external environmental factors are not a major concern. They allow for easy access and inspection of the vessel. Crates, on the other hand, are essential for long-distance or more hazardous transportation conditions. They protect the vessels from weather, impacts, and other potential damages, ensuring the vessel’s integrity upon arrival.
While there are general guidelines for the transportation of heavy machinery and equipment, specific regulations or standards for using skids or crates can vary depending on the nature of the pressure vessel, its size, weight, and the transportation distance and mode. Industry standards often recommend crates for international or long-distance shipping due to their protective nature. However, for local transport or when the vessel will be frequently moved, skids might be more practical.
Absolutely. Both skids and crates can and often should be customized to fit the specific dimensions and requirements of different pressure vessels. This customization ensures maximum protection and stability. Factors like the vessel’s weight, shape, and fragility are considered in the design of the skid or crate. Customization can range from adding additional support structures inside a crate to modifying the skid design for better weight distribution.
Environmental considerations play a crucial role in choosing between skids and crates. Crates, being more enclosed, offer better protection against environmental factors like moisture, dust, and temperature fluctuations. This is particularly important for pressure vessels sensitive to such conditions. On the other hand, skids are more open, which might not be suitable for harsh environmental conditions but can be more sustainable due to less material usage. The choice should align with the environmental exposure during transportation and the sustainability goals of the company.
